What MERV Ratings Actually Mean for Allergy Sufferers
MERV stands for Minimum Efficiency Reporting Value—a standardized scale from 1 to 20 that measures how effectively an HVAC furnace air filter captures airborne particles. For allergy sufferers, the key isn’t just the number; it’s understanding which particle sizes each rating traps.
Lower-rated filters (MERV 1–4) catch large debris, such as dust bunnies and carpet fibers, but let most allergens pass right through. Mid-range filters (MERV 5–8) start capturing mold spores and dust mite debris. But the real allergy relief begins at MERV 9 and above, where filters target fine particles like pollen, pet dander, and smaller mold spores.
In our testing at FilterKnowHow.com, we’ve found that most allergy sufferers don’t notice meaningful symptom improvement until they reach at least MERV 11.
Why MERV 11–13 Works Best for Residential Allergy Control
Here’s what makes MERV 11 to MERV 13 the ideal range for homes with allergies:
MERV 11 captures particles down to 1.0 micron with approximately 65–79% efficiency. This includes most pollen, dust mite allergens, mold spores, and pet dander. For mild to moderate allergy sufferers, this rating delivers noticeable relief without restricting airflow.
MERV 13 reaches 85–90% efficiency and begins capturing some bacteria and smoke particles. This is our go-to recommendation for households with severe allergies, asthma, or multiple pets. However, it does require a system with adequate airflow capacity.
We’ve seen MERV 13 replacement filters transform air quality in homes where occupants previously relied on multiple room air purifiers. But we’ve also seen them cause problems in older systems—which brings us to an important consideration.
The Airflow Trade-Off: Why Higher Isn’t Always Better
One of the biggest mistakes we see homeowners make is jumping straight to MERV 16 or higher, assuming more filtration equals better allergy relief. In reality, residential HVAC systems aren’t designed for hospital-grade filters.
When a filter is too restrictive for your system, airflow drops. Reduced airflow means fewer air changes per hour—so your HVAC cycles the same stale, allergen-laden air instead of filtering fresh volumes. We’ve tested homes where switching from a MERV 16 down to a MERV 13 actually improved allergy symptoms because the system moved air more efficiently.
Signs your AC furnace filter may be too restrictive include: weak airflow from vents, your system running longer cycles, increased energy bills, or ice forming on evaporator coils.
Before choosing MERV 13 for your 12x16x2 filter, check your system’s specifications or consult your HVAC technician about the maximum filter pressure drop.
Choosing the Right MERV Rating for Your Specific Situation
Not every household needs the same filter. Based on our experience helping readers find the right match, here’s a quick framework:
Choose MERV 11 if: You have mild seasonal allergies, an older HVAC system, or you’re upgrading from a basic fiberglass filter for the first time.
Choose MERV 13 if: You have severe allergies or asthma, multiple pets, household members with respiratory conditions, or a newer HVAC system confirmed to handle higher-rated filters.

Filter Maintenance Tips for Allergy-Prone Households
Even the best MERV-rated filter won’t help if it’s clogged or overdue for replacement. In homes with allergies, we recommend checking filters monthly and replacing them every 60–90 days—more frequently during high-pollen seasons or if you have multiple pets.
A dirty filter doesn’t just reduce efficiency; it can release trapped allergens back into your air as airflow forces particles through degraded filter media. Readers often ask us why their allergies flare up suddenly after weeks of relief—and a neglected filter is usually the culprit.
Set a calendar reminder, or consider a filter subscription service to keep fresh 12x16x2 filters on hand. Consistent replacement is one of the simplest yet most overlooked steps for maintaining healthy indoor air.

Q: Can I use a 2-inch thick filter if my system currently has a 1-inch filter?
A: No—not without modification.
Why it matters:
- A 12x16x2 is twice as thick as a 12x16x1
- Forcing it into a 1-inch slot restricts airflow
- Results in stressed blower motors and potential housing damage
The appeal is understandable—thicker filters offer greater dust-holding capacity and longer life.
The right approach:
- Consult an HVAC technician
- Upgrade your filter housing to accommodate a 2-inch depth
- Then enjoy the benefits of a thicker filter
In our experience, it’s a worthwhile investment for allergy households—but only when done properly.
